Security Concerns have been significantly heightened for the Euro 2024 group stage match between England and Serbia, a fixture deemed “high-risk” by German authorities. The historical presence of problematic fan groups associated with both nations has led to extensive planning and deployment of resources to prevent potential disorder and ensure the safety of all attendees. This match is under intense scrutiny from all angles.
German police are particularly wary of the potential for clashes between English and Serbian hooligan elements. Reports indicated that a significant number of known Serbian “ultras” were expected to attend, alongside a large contingent of English supporters. These Security Concerns prompted proactive measures to minimize any risk of violence before, during, and after the game, particularly in Gelsenkirchen.
In response, a robust security operation was put in place. Over 1,000 police officers were on duty, with additional support from English and Serbian police liaison officers who could identify high-risk individuals. Furthermore, measures such as serving only low-alcohol beer in the stadium and keeping fan groups separated were implemented to mitigate risks.
The history of fan violence at previous major tournaments, particularly involving England supporters in Euro 2016 and the Euro 2020 final, contributed to these elevated Security Concerns. German authorities were determined to avoid any repeat of such chaotic scenes, working closely with UEFA and foreign police forces to enforce strict regulations.
Pre-match incidents, including a brawl in Gelsenkirchen between a small group of English and Serbian fans, underscored the validity of these apprehensions. While isolated, these skirmishes served as a stark reminder of the underlying tensions and the constant vigilance required from law enforcement to prevent wider disturbances.
